Output dcfad82491e4d8d55a2b45ccc41ebc1c8b65b95ec98e468fa477cbbc8a934c07:1

value
149153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6177e51a8f2ce986abae9ffbf26ede8c5c25469 OP_EQUAL
address
3MD2fwvo6gf5MqYGs8N6RjkcVSX8Ec2NfG
transaction
dcfad82491e4d8d55a2b45ccc41ebc1c8b65b95ec98e468fa477cbbc8a934c07
confirmations
186258
spent
true